Model Specifications (e.g., MBF8001, MBF8002)

The Atosa freezer models MBF8001 and MBF8002 are designed for high-performance refrigeration. The MBF8001 operates at 115V, 60Hz, with a temperature range of -8°F to 1°F, making it ideal for commercial use. It uses R290 refrigerant, known for its efficiency and eco-friendliness. The MBF8002 shares similar specifications but offers slightly larger capacity and advanced features. Both models are built with durable materials and modern technology to ensure reliable operation. Location and Placement Requirements

Proper placement of your Atosa freezer is crucial for optimal performance. Ensure the unit is installed on a level, stable surface to prevent uneven operation and maintain proper door alignment. Place the freezer away from direct sunlight and heat sources, such as radiators or ovens, to avoid temperature fluctuations; Maintain at least 4 inches of clearance on all sides for adequate ventilation and compressor efficiency. Avoid installing the freezer in areas with high humidity or exposure to water. For models like MBF8001GR and MBF8002GR, ensure the electrical supply matches the unit’s voltage requirements (e.g., 115V or 208-230V). Step-by-Step Installation Guide

Begin by carefully unpacking the freezer from its cardboard box and inspecting for any damage. Place the unit in the desired location, ensuring it is level and stable. Check the floor for evenness and use shims if necessary to adjust the legs. Plug the freezer into a grounded electrical outlet, ensuring the voltage matches the unit’s specifications (e.g., 115V or 208-230V). Turn on the power and allow the unit to cool down to the set temperature before loading. For models like MBF8001GR and MBF8002GR, refer to the manual for specific voltage requirements. Initial Setup and Programming

After installation, initialize your Atosa freezer by pressing and holding the SET and DOWN ARROW buttons for 3 seconds to enter programming mode. Use the arrow keys to select your preferred temperature unit (Celsius or Fahrenheit) and press SET to confirm. Adjust the temperature setting within the recommended range (-8°F to 1°F) using the UP and DOWN arrows. Save your settings by pressing SET again. For models like MBF8001GR and MBF8002GR, ensure the unit is set to the correct voltage (115V or 208-230V). Allow the freezer to cycle and stabilize before adding contents. Refer to the manual for additional programming options, such as defrost cycles or door settings, to customize operation for your needs. Always review and confirm settings before first use.

Daily Operation and Best Practices

For optimal performance, ensure the freezer is set to the recommended temperature range, typically between -8°F and 1°F. Regularly monitor the temperature display and adjust as needed using the digital controls. To defrost manually, press and hold the DEF key for over 2 seconds until “DEF” appears on the display. Always keep the freezer doors closed to maintain temperature consistency. Avoid overstocking, as this can impede airflow and reduce efficiency. Clean the condenser coils monthly to prevent dust buildup and ensure proper airflow. Rotate stored items to maintain inventory freshness and prevent spoilage. Defrosting and Maintenance Modes

The Atosa freezer features both automatic and manual defrosting options to ensure efficient operation. For manual defrosting, press and hold the DEF key for more than 2 seconds until “DEF” appears on the display. This mode temporarily stops the compressor, allowing ice to melt. Regular defrosting prevents excessive ice buildup and maintains optimal performance. Models like the MBF8001GR and MBF8002GR include advanced defrosting cycles that automatically manage the process. During maintenance, ensure the drain system is clear to prevent water accumulation. Always unplug the freezer before performing manual defrosting or maintenance. Cleaning and Sanitizing the Freezer

Regular cleaning and sanitizing are crucial for maintaining hygiene and efficiency in your Atosa freezer. Start by turning off the freezer and unplugging it for safety. Remove all contents, shelves, and drawers, and wash them with a mild detergent solution. Wipe the interior with a mixture of water and food-safe sanitizer, avoiding abrasive cleaners that may damage surfaces. Pay attention to door seals, handles, and drain areas to prevent mold and bacteria buildup. Rinse thoroughly and dry with a clean towel to prevent water spots. Allow the freezer to air dry before reconnecting power. Regular sanitizing ensures a clean environment for stored items and prevents contamination. Emergency Procedures and Shutdown

In case of an emergency, such as a malfunction or safety hazard, immediately switch off the freezer’s power at the electrical outlet or circuit breaker. Do not attempt to repair the unit yourself. If there is a risk of fire or gas leak, evacuate the area and contact emergency services. For compressor or refrigerant issues, ensure the area is well-ventilated and avoid direct contact with leaking substances. Contact Atosa support or a certified technician for professional assistance. Always follow the shutdown procedure outlined in the manual to prevent further damage or safety risks. Keep the freezer door closed during an emergency to maintain internal conditions until professional help arrives.
